Tuna Poke Bowl Recipe: 5 Reasons You’ll Love This Delightful Dish


  • Author: Juanita A. Smith
  • Total Time: 45 minutes
  • Yield: 2 servings 1x
  • Diet: Gluten Free

Description

A fresh and flavorful tuna poke bowl recipe.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 cup sushi rice
  • 1 1/4 cups water
  • 1/2 lb fresh tuna, diced
  • 2 tablespoons soy sauce
  • 1 tablespoon sesame oil
  • 1 avocado, sliced
  • 1/2 cucumber, sliced
  • 1/4 cup green onions, chopped
  • 1 tablespoon sesame seeds
  • seaweed salad (optional)

Instructions

  1. Rinse the sushi rice under cold water until the water runs clear.
  2. Add rice and water to a pot and bring to a boil.
  3. Reduce heat, cover, and simmer for 20 minutes.
  4. Remove from heat and let it sit covered for 10 minutes.
  5. In a bowl, combine diced tuna, soy sauce, and sesame oil.
  6. In serving bowls, layer rice, tuna mixture, avocado, cucumber, and green onions.
  7. Sprinkle sesame seeds on top.
  8. Serve with seaweed salad if desired.

Notes

  • Use sushi-grade tuna for safety.
  • Adjust the soy sauce to taste.
  • Customize toppings as you like.
